如何在Leaflet中偏移和缩放自定义切片图层?

时间:2017-03-09 22:44:42

标签: javascript leaflet tile zoomify

我想使用Leaflet Zoomify插件的this fork(更新以使用最新的Leaflet版本)来显示自定义地图(巨大纹理~30000x70000)。

我需要在地图上使用地理坐标(设置标记),并想知道最好的方法是什么,因为在通过插件初始化时无法设置偏移,缩放或边界

  • 最初我认为在Leaflet中应该有一种方法可以通过设置图像边界来TileLayer校准ImageOverlayconversion methods。但事实似乎并非如此。
  • 这是插件应该照顾的东西吗?在这种情况下,我会在回购中提出一个问题。
  • 我也看到了{{3}} 在传单。我想知道最好的方法是使用这些方法将地理坐标转换为像素吗?

我也打开以切换到另一种文件格式和插件。

非常感谢任何建议 非常感谢!

1 个答案:

答案 0 :(得分:0)

毕竟,我在没有Zoomify的情况下走了一条完全不同的路线,我认为这在我的情况下更有意义 我使用QGIS对我的自定义图层进行地理参考,然后将其导出为this tutorial之后的GeoTIFF。我将其上传到Mapbox并将其烘焙成地图样式,同时将其与Mapbox / OSM中的其他地图功能混合使用。